This is an automated email from the ASF dual-hosted git repository.
mblow p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/asterixdb.git.
from 866d4c8 [NO ISSUE][COMP] Refactor drop dataverse and drop function
new 26e411e [ASTERIXDB-2754][COMP] LoadRecordFieldsRule must clone
expression
new 9ac7816 [NO ISSUE][RT] Support External Datasets Rebalance
new 8a64bf8 [ASTERIXDB-2757] Properly handle include/exclude pattern
translation
new b44f5c3 [NO ISSUE] Redact sensitive data from statement logging
new ad3ee2e [ASTERIXDB-2758][TEST] Test for ensuring translation from
wildcard pattern to REGEX is done properly
new c476a98 [NO ISSUE][STO] Use Index Resolved Path
new d4ca925 Merge branch 'gerrit/mad-hatter'
The 7 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
.../optimizer/rules/LoadRecordFieldsRule.java | 2 +-
.../api/http/server/QueryServiceServlet.java | 7 +-
.../message/ExecuteStatementRequestMessage.java | 2 +-
.../asterix/hyracks/bootstrap/CCApplication.java | 3 +
.../asterix/hyracks/bootstrap/NCApplication.java | 3 +
.../org/apache/asterix/utils/RebalanceUtil.java | 8 +-
.../org/apache/asterix/utils/RedactionUtil.java | 41 +++----
.../external_dataset/aws/WildCardToRegexTest.java | 97 +++++++++++++++++
.../optimizerts/queries/common-expr-01.sqlpp | 65 +++++++++++
.../optimizerts/results/common-expr-01.plan | 68 ++++++++++++
.../include-exclude/include-11/test.000.ddl.sqlpp | 35 +++---
.../test.001.query.sqlpp | 0
.../include-11}/test.099.ddl.sqlpp | 0
.../include-exclude/include-12/test.000.ddl.sqlpp | 37 ++++---
.../test.001.query.sqlpp | 0
.../include-12}/test.099.ddl.sqlpp | 0
.../include-10}/result.001.adm | 0
.../{include-9 => include-11}/result.001.adm | 0
.../include-12}/result.001.adm | 0
.../runtimets/testsuite_external_dataset.xml | 11 +-
.../record/reader/aws/AwsS3InputStreamFactory.java | 4 +-
.../asterix/external/util/ExternalDataUtils.java | 119 ++++++++++++---------
.../evaluators/functions/StringEvaluatorUtils.java | 4 +-
.../storage/am/common/build/IndexBuilder.java | 27 ++---
.../java/org/apache/hyracks/util/ILogRedactor.java | 8 ++
.../org/apache/hyracks/util/LogRedactionUtil.java | 9 ++
26 files changed, 422 insertions(+), 128 deletions(-)
copy
hyracks-fullstack/hyracks/hyracks-util/src/main/java/org/apache/hyracks/util/LogRedactionUtil.java
=>
asterixdb/asterix-app/src/main/java/org/apache/asterix/utils/RedactionUtil.java
(53%)
create mode 100644
asterixdb/asterix-app/src/test/java/org/apache/asterix/test/external_dataset/aws/WildCardToRegexTest.java
create mode 100644
asterixdb/asterix-app/src/test/resources/optimizerts/queries/common-expr-01.sqlpp
create mode 100644
asterixdb/asterix-app/src/test/resources/optimizerts/results/common-expr-01.plan
copy
hyracks-fullstack/hyracks/hyracks-util/src/main/java/org/apache/hyracks/util/ILogRedactor.java
=>
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/include-exclude/include-11/test.000.ddl.sqlpp
(62%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/include-exclude/{include-all
=> include-11}/test.001.query.sqlpp (100%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/{no-files-returned/include-no-files
=> include-exclude/include-11}/test.099.ddl.sqlpp (100%)
copy
hyracks-fullstack/hyracks/hyracks-util/src/main/java/org/apache/hyracks/util/ILogRedactor.java
=>
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/include-exclude/include-12/test.000.ddl.sqlpp
(56%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/include-exclude/{include-all
=> include-12}/test.001.query.sqlpp (100%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/external-dataset/aws/s3/{no-files-returned/include-no-files
=> include-exclude/include-12}/test.099.ddl.sqlpp (100%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/results/external-dataset/aws/s3/{no-files-returned/include-no-files
=> include-exclude/include-10}/result.001.adm (100%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/results/external-dataset/aws/s3/include-exclude/{include-9
=> include-11}/result.001.adm (100%)
copy
asterixdb/asterix-app/src/test/resources/runtimets/results/external-dataset/aws/s3/{no-files-returned/include-no-files
=> include-exclude/include-12}/result.001.adm (100%)